Graham Partners

Graham Partners is a private equity investment firm founded in 1988 and based in Newtown Square, Pennsylvania. The firm specializes in acquiring and investing in growth-oriented companies across various sectors, including industrial technology, software, medical devices and life sciences, consumer and food manufacturing, and advanced manufacturing. With a focus on the United States and Canada, Graham Partners leverages its expertise to support the development and expansion of its portfolio companies. The firm is also a Registered Investment Adviser, reflecting its commitment to professional standards in investment management.

Past deals in British Columbia

Novarc Technologies

Series B in 2025
Novarc Technologies Inc. is a Vancouver-based company specializing in the design and manufacture of innovative robotic solutions for industrial applications, particularly in pipe welding. Established in 2013, Novarc has made significant advancements in collaborative robotics, offering products such as the Spool Welding Robot, which is recognized as the first of its kind for pipe welding. The company also provides custom robotic solutions for various applications, including arc welding, food and beverage handling, and palletizing. With a dedicated team of engineers and scientists, Novarc Technologies aims to address complex industrial automation challenges through the development of collaborative robots and artificial intelligence systems.
